Please go.through my previously detailed posts about windows phone (wp).
Basically the windows phone ecosystem is much like the iOS systems where till one year back nothing could be done without iTunes.
Similarly in windows phones you need zune all the time on your pc to transfer files and songs and videos which sometimes tends to get tiring as you cant even share photos on bluetooth.
This is the major problem of owning an iPhone or a Windows phone. If this is not much of a problem for you then you can opt for the wp. Id suggest go for the samsung omnia even though i myself have lumia. Reason - omnia offers better battery life and since it uses Super Amoled screen its far better contrasts and also far more energy efficient than thr lumia 710 that uses lcd screen. This translates to longer battery backup.

Coming to your 2nd query voip on phones without front cameras is not as fun as you arent able to see the person. I think the omnia has dual cameras and is a better choice for Voip. Skype has released its beta for wp7.5 and also other voip softwares are there like tango which i use mostly till skype came. Till now its been good. So voip is not a problem.

Music quality: the default lumia earphones are very mild and dont offer much punch even in my lumia800. So i guess you can try it out with your earphones at the shop and i guess samsung should sound better.

Nope there is no flash support on wp. In fact android and nokia symbian seems to be the only OSes supporting flash at the moment.

And yes windows phones is zippy as hell. 1.4ghz Snapdragon processor is what you get in all wp whereas at the price range15k android phones will be maximum 1ghz. Mostly 800Mhz. So wp is damn fast.

Btw even skype can be used to call the landline. Do check it out. One year back for me it was 33c. I dont know the current price.
